Step 4: Password reset flow revamp. The new flow in Tallowgate Identity replaces emailed plaintext tokens with single-use signed links that expire after fifteen minutes. Before deploying, confirm the legacy reset endpoint is disabled and that rate limiting applies per account rather than per IP. Token signing now uses the rotated keyset introduced in Step 2. For your review, the exact configuration the reset service will boot with in the pilot environment appears below.

settings of yageg-yahap:
[gorael]
team = olieth
access_code = ac_941d74
owner = brieth.aldiel
host = gorael.tolvaqio.internal
port = 6379
peer = briwyn.urlaqtech.internal
salt = 116e6622
pin = 1957

Quick recap of the Westvale region sales review for you before you take the chair. Q3 came in a touch soft — roughly 4% under plan — mostly down to slow uptake of the Brindlewood product line in the coastal branches. Marta Quill's team in Ashenport outperformed again, which is worth a closer look. Costs held steady, so margin damage was limited. The note below outlines where we go next.

confidential, kagup-bafog: Fraaxax Group is in early talks to buy Soroxox Group for about $343.8 million. The Olidor launch date is June 14, and nothing goes to the press before then. Legal wants the Aldmirek Logistics term sheet signed before July 23.

Subject: Offline mode branch ready for review

Hi team,

The offline mode for the Moorfield survey app is finally review-ready. Surveys queue locally in an encrypted store and sync once connectivity returns — conflict resolution is last-write-wins for now, flagged in the PR notes. Please poke at the sync retry logic especially; that's where the dragons live. To run the sync tests against our partner sandbox, authenticate with the token below.

Cheers,
Ilsa

portal login ticket: eyJhbGciOiJIUzI1NiIsInR5cCI6IkpXVCJ9.eyJzdWIiOiI0Z4ywpUMsBIn0.ca5FVhkdBXa3